The story

Griffin was founded to be the programmable bank layer that other fintechs and software companies build on — a UK-chartered bank with a developer-first API. Unlike most BaaS providers that front for a sponsor bank under a license arrangement, Griffin pursued its own full UK banking licence (applied 2022, mobilisation 2023, full licence March 2024), which allows it to offer FSCS-protected deposits natively. This vertical integration of banking licence + modern core + KYC product (Verify) differentiates it from earlier-generation BaaS players that relied entirely on partner banks. The embedded finance angle is central: Griffin sells regulated infrastructure (accounts, payments, onboarding) to fintechs, not end-customers.

Product timeline
2017
Griffin founded by David Jarvis and Allen Rohner with the mission to build a bank developers could build on via APIs.· banking
2022
Applied for UK banking licence with the PRA; raised $15.5M seed led by Notion Capital.· banking
2023
Entered mobilisation phase under UK banking licence; launched Verify (KYB/KYC onboarding product) with pre-integrated Veriff ID&V.· banking
2024
Full UK banking licence granted by PRA/FCA in March 2024; raised Series A led by NordicNinja VC; launched FSCS-protected embedded bank accounts and savings products at scale.· banking
2024
Launched dedicated safeguarding, client money, and savings account products for fintechs, proptechs, and FX/remittance companies.· banking
